Асинхронные триггеры в SQL Server - PullRequest
0 голосов
/ 05 октября 2010

Мне нужно знать, что означает «асинхронный триггер» и есть ли разница между асинхронными триггерами и обычными триггерами, которые используются в SQL Server после или до вставки, обновления, удаления.

1 Ответ

2 голосов
/ 05 октября 2010

Я думаю, вы запутались с компонентами Service Brokers.

Триггеры всегда выполняют синхронно в контексте данной транзакции.Если вам нужно вызвать асинхронный процесс из в триггере, используйте Service Broker .

Это в основном похоже на очередь - вы отправляете что-то в очереди, затем вы можете продолжать заниматься своим делом, не дожидаясь его завершения.

Однако, это намного больше, прочитайте ссылку.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...